This is a petition filed under Section 438 of the Code of Criminal Procedure seeking pre-arrest bail in a case registered against the petitioners vide FIR No. 88 dated 13.06.2015 under Sections 452, 295-A, 354, 341, 323, 149, 506 IPC at Police Station Daba, district Ludhiana.
Learned counsel for the State (on instructions from ASI Gurjeet Singh, who is present in court) submits that pursuant to order dated 16.07.2015, petitioners have joined the investigation and is no longer required for custodial interrogation. In view of the above, order dated 16.07.2015 is made absolute subject to the conditions envisaged under Section 438(2) Cr.P.C.
Disposed of.
